The Crabs2 data file at the text website shows several variables that may be associated with = whether a female horseshoe crab is monandrous (eggs fertilized by a single male crab) or polyandrous (eggs fertilized by multiple males). Using year of observation, Fcolor = the female crab’s color (1 = dark, 3 = medium, 5 = light), Fsurf = her surface condition (values 1, 2, 3, 4, 5 with lower values representing worse), FCW = female’s carapace width, AMCW = attached male’s carapace width, AMcolor = attached male’s color, and AMsurf = attached male’s surface condition, conduct a logistic model-building process. Prepare a report summarizing this process, with edited software output as an appendix. Interpret results for your chosen model.
